Underline each adjective clause in the sentence: My teacher, who is from Morocco, does not speak with an accent.
My teacher, who is from Morocco
who is from Morocco
does not speak with an accent
My teacher
Answer explanation
The adjective clause in the sentence is 'who is from Morocco'. It provides additional information about 'My teacher'. The other options do not contain a clause that modifies a noun.

Underline each adjective clause in the sentence: That movie, which was nominated for an Oscar, was showing at the local theater.
That movie
which was nominated for an Oscar
was showing at the local theater
at the local theater
Answer explanation
The adjective clause "which was nominated for an Oscar" describes the noun "movie". It provides additional information about the movie, making it the correct choice for underlining.

Underline each adjective clause in the sentence: One bird that was red with a yellow beak was hogging the bird feeder.
One bird that was red with a yellow beak
that was red with a yellow beak
was hogging the bird feeder
the bird feeder
Answer explanation
The adjective clause "that was red with a yellow beak" describes the noun "bird". It provides more information about which bird is being referred to, making it the correct choice.
